- A gun battle erupted at Seattle's packed Bite of Seattle food festival, killing three people and wounding four others, including a 2-year-old boy, as thousands fled in panic.
- Witnesses described scenes of pure chaos, with parents grabbing children, baby strollers overturning and crowds sprinting for cover as cries of "Shooter!" echoed through the festival.
- Police believe two suspects were shooting at each other in the middle of the crowd. One was arrested at the scene, but a second suspect remains on the run.
- The annual festival, which draws hundreds of thousands of visitors beneath Seattle's Space Needle, was transformed from a family celebration into a sprawling crime scene as vendors abandoned food stalls and terrified festivalgoers ran for their lives.
- Investigators have recovered two firearms and say they are still trying to determine what sparked the deadly exchange, though officials say there is no ongoing threat to the public.
